Drain Line Replacement in Denver, CO

Drain line replacement services involve removing and installing new underground pipes that carry wastewater away from a property. This type of project is often necessary when existing drain lines become severely damaged, corroded, or blocked, leading to persistent backups or leaks. Property owners typically request this service for homes experiencing frequent clogs, foul odors, or signs of pipe deterioration, especially in older buildings or after severe weather events that may compromise underground plumbing.

Before requesting drain line repl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work, including the extent of the damage, the type of replacement pipe used, and any necessary excavation or disruptions to the property. It’s also important to consider the potential impact on landscaping or driveways and to inquire about the durability and lifespan of the new drain lines.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ure the replacement meets the property’s needs and prevents future drainage issues.

Common Drain Line Replacement Jobs

Drain line replacement involves removing and installing new pipes to ensure proper drainage.

Main sewer line replacement addresses blockages or damage in the primary drain system.

Underground drain pipe replacement restores functionality for buried piping systems.

Kitchen and bathroom drain line replacement fixes clogs and leaks affecting household plumbing fixtures.

Foundation drain line replacement prevents water buildup around the foundation that can cause damage.

Storm drain line replacement ensures effective runoff management to protect property from flooding.

Drain Line Replacement Questions

What is drain line replacement? It involves removing and installing new drain lines to ensure proper wastewater flow from a property.

When is drain line replacement necessary? Replacement is needed when existing drain lines are damaged, cracked, or clogged beyond repair.

What types of drain lines can be replaced? Common replacements include main sewer lines, storm drains, and interior piping systems.

What signs indicate drain line issues? Signs include persistent backups, foul odors, slow drains, or visible leaks around pipes.
